Transaction 72dd39c7a94387606468d5731abfc73d39113229929d6298f34b26bb95dcc5e6
1 Input
1 Output
-
72dd39c7a94387606468d5731abfc73d39113229929d6298f34b26bb95dcc5e6:0
- value
- 10564644
- script pubkey
- OP_0 OP_PUSHBYTES_20 5de239237ac7b477cf7005e541f459ebdb910c1f
- address
- bc1qth3rjgm6c7680nmsqhj5razea0dezrql66vh9k